It’s not a strong free-agent class at linebacker. Brian Orakpo and Jason Worilds are off the market. I'm guessing Pittsburgh cuts Lamarr Woodley and Dallas cuts DeMarcus Ware, so those are potential options. You could also look at Anthony Spencer on a one-year deal. None of those guys fit Ted Thompson’s criteria, but things need to fall in place before a potential linebacker emerges.

Houston is one of the best free-agent defensive linemen available. He’s a tremendous run defender. He has improved considerably since his days at Texas. You have to defend the run to beat Seattle and San Francisco. Getting a player like Houston is a good first step. His pass rush isn’t bad, either. I still believe Green Bay wants Datone Jones and Mike Daniels to rush in their sub packages, but Jones could move to outside linebacker, and Houston could lineup with Daniels.

Arthur Jones is also pretty good. He’s a quality run defender, who can get an occasional push as a rusher. He‘s the cheaper alterative. In my assessment, Green Bay needs one defensive lineman, one (maybe two) linebackers, and a safety this off-season. I don’t want to set myself up for disappointment, but Houston’s a big first step toward improving the defense.
